Praia do Sarney, located in Aruana, Sergipe, Brazil, offers visitors a serene coastal escape with golden sands and Atlantic Ocean vistas. Known for its laid-back atmosphere, this beach attracts both locals and tourists seeking relaxation and water activities. The nearby Aruanã Eco Praia Hotel enhances accessibility, providing beachfront convenience across the street from the shoreline.

The beach's proximity to Aracaju's cultural landmarks, such as the Arcos da Orla de Atalaia monument, adds to its appeal. Visitors often highlight the blend of natural beauty and nearby amenities, including beach clubs and restaurants, making it a versatile destination for families and adventure seekers alike.

The Aruanã Eco Praia Hotel stands as the primary accommodation near Praia do Sarney, offering direct beach access across the street. Guests enjoy free breakfast, an outdoor pool, and balconies with ocean views. The hotel’s suites feature soaking tubs and four-poster beds, while its kid-friendly amenities and beachfront restaurant cater to families.

Nearby alternatives include Jatobá Praia Hotel (3 miles away) and Algas Marinhas Hotel (2.9 miles away), though specific website links are unavailable. These options provide budget-friendly stays with beach proximity, though amenities are more basic compared to Aruanã Eco Praia.

Swimming and beachcombing dominate the daytime agenda, while nearby kite surfing stations cater to adventure seekers. The beach’s calm waters near the shore are ideal for families, though ocean currents require caution.

Evening activities often revolve around sunset views and dining at beachfront restaurants. The proximity to Aracaju’s cultural sites, like the Oceanário project, allows for day trips combining coastal relaxation with educational outings.
